Andrés Schetino (born 26 May 1994) is an Uruguayan footballer who plays as a midfielder for Livorno on loan from ACF Fiorentina.[1]
Club career
Schetino is a youth exponent from Club Atlético Fénix. At 17 August 2013, he made his first team debut in a league game against El Tanque Sisley.[2] In January 2016, he signed for A.C.F. Fiorentina. He will spend the rest of the season 2015/16 at Livorno.
